#945bbd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#945bbd is composed of 58% red, 35.7%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.7% cyan, 51.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 274.9 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 54.9%. #945bbd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b6ff with #29007b.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#945bbd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030204 is the darkest color, while #f8f5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#945bbd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8791 is the less saturated color, while #9e1dfb is the most saturated one.
